The Abundance of Water: More Than Meets the Eye
While the vast oceans dominate our perception of Earth's water, the reality is far more complex. Many believe that the majority of Earth's water is readily accessible for drinking and other uses. This is demonstrably false. The vast majority of Earth's water – approximately 97% – is saltwater, located in oceans, seas, and bays. This leaves only a small fraction as freshwater, which is further divided into readily accessible sources and those locked away in glaciers, ice caps, and underground aquifers. Understanding this distribution is crucial to appreciating the challenges of water scarcity and management.
Dissecting Common Misconceptions
Before revealing the true statement, let's debunk some prevalent misunderstandings about Earth's water:
-
Myth 1: Most of Earth's water is fresh and easily accessible. As discussed above, this is incorrect. The overwhelming majority of Earth's water is saltwater, rendering it unsuitable for direct human consumption or agriculture without extensive treatment.
-
Myth 2: The amount of water on Earth is constant. While the total amount of water remains relatively constant, its distribution and accessibility are constantly changing due to factors like climate change, pollution, and unsustainable practices. Glacial melting, for example, affects sea levels and freshwater availability.
-
Myth 3: Water is evenly distributed across the globe. The distribution of water is highly uneven, with some regions experiencing water scarcity while others suffer from floods. This uneven distribution is a major factor contributing to global water conflicts and challenges.
The True Statement:
Considering the above points, the true statement about water on Earth is that most of Earth's water is saltwater, located primarily in oceans, and only a small percentage is readily available freshwater. This statement accurately reflects the reality of water distribution and the challenges associated with its sustainable management. Understanding this crucial fact is paramount for addressing water scarcity and promoting responsible water usage globally.

The Role of Water in the Ecosystem
Water plays a fundamental role in maintaining the balance of ecosystems around the world. It is essential for plant growth, animal survival, and the overall health of the environment. The water cycle, encompassing evaporation, condensation, precipitation, and runoff, continuously shapes landscapes and supports a vast array of life forms.
